Preparing Cinnamon Roll Bliss Bars
When it comes to desserts that make your kitchen smell divine while delivering a delightfully sweet surprise, Cinnamon Roll Bliss Bars are at the top of my list. These bars combine the classic flavors of cinnamon rolls in a portable form, making them perfect for a brunch gathering or even a weekday treat. Let’s dive into the preparation process step-by-step, so you can create your own batch of bliss!
Gather Your Tools and Ingredients
Before you get cooking, it’s essential to have everything in place. Here’s what you’ll need:
Tools:
- 9×13 inch baking pan
- Mixing bowls
- Whisk
- Rubber spatula or wooden spoon
- Parchment paper (for easy cleanup)
Ingredients:
- 2 cups all-purpose flour
- 1 cup brown sugar
- 1 cup granulated sugar
- 1 tablespoon baking powder
- ½ teaspoon salt
- ¾ cup unsalted butter, softened
- 2 large eggs
- 1 tablespoon vanilla extract
- 1 cup powdered sugar (for frosting)
- 4 oz cream cheese, softened
- 1 tablespoon milk (or a non-dairy alternative)
- 2 teaspoons ground cinnamon
Having all your ingredients and tools ready will make the process much smoother—trust me!
Mix the Dry Ingredients for the Base
In a mixing bowl, combine the flour, brown sugar, granulated sugar, baking powder, and salt. Whisk these together until they’re well mixed. The blend of sugars will provide that wonderful sweetness, while the baking powder will help the bars rise and stay airy.
Create the Moist Base Mixture
In another bowl, cream together the butter and eggs until smooth. You can use a hand mixer or simply a whisk; just make sure you achieve a fluffy texture. Then, add the vanilla extract to the mix and stir. Combine this wet mixture with your dry ingredients, mixing just until everything is combined. At this stage, feel free to let your creativity flow—this is the foundation of your Cinnamon Roll Bliss Bars!
Press the Base into the Baking Pan
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Line your baking pan with parchment paper, letting it hang over the sides for easy removal later. Using your spatula, press the base mixture evenly into the pan. Remember, you want a nice, flat surface that will crisp up nicely as it bakes!
Prepare the Cinnamon Filling
For the filling, combine the brown sugar and ground cinnamon in a small bowl. Sprinkle this mixture generously over the pressed base. This is where the magic happens—every bite will be infused with that cozy cinnamon flavor we all love.
Bake and Cool the Bars
Pop your pan into the oven and bake for about 25-30 minutes or until the edges are golden-brown and a toothpick comes out clean. Once done, remove the pan from the oven and let the bars cool completely in the pan. You want to make sure they’re cool to the touch before moving on to the frosting.
Make the Cream Cheese Frosting
While the bars are cooling, it’s time to whip up the creamy topping. In a separate bowl, combine the cream cheese, powdered sugar, and milk, mixing until smooth and spreadable. This frosting adds a delightful tang that perfectly contrasts the sweetness of the bars.
Frost and Cut into Bars
Once your Cinnamon Roll Bliss Bars are cool, gently lift them out of the pan using the parchment paper. Spread the cream cheese frosting over the top, and cut them into squares. Enjoy them as a treat for yourself, share with friends, or take them to the office for a sweet surprise.

Cooking Tips for Cinnamon Roll Bliss Bars
Avoiding Common Baking Mistakes
Baking the perfect Cinnamon Roll Bliss Bars can feel daunting, but avoiding a few common pitfalls will make the process smoother. First, make sure your ingredients are at room temperature; this ensures even mixing and better texture. Don’t overmix your batter—just stir until combined; overmixing can lead to dense bars instead of light, fluffy ones. Also, be sure to measure ingredients accurately. For example, spooning flour into a cup instead of scooping it directly can prevent overly dry or wet results. If you’re curious about precise measuring techniques, check out resources from King Arthur Baking for helpful tips.
Storage Tips for Freshness
After baking your Cinnamon Roll Bliss Bars, storing them right is key to keeping that fresh, gooey goodness. Allow the bars to cool completely before covering them. Use an airtight container to maintain moisture, or wrap them in plastic wrap followed by aluminum foil. If you plan to enjoy them later, you can also freeze the unglazed bars wrapped tightly; just thaw them at room temperature and glaze them before serving for optimal taste. PrintCinnamon Roll Bliss Bars: The Easy Indulgent Treat You’ll Love
Cinnamon Roll Bliss Bars are a deliciously easy dessert that combines the flavors of cinnamon rolls with a gooey, chewy bar format. Perfect for any occasion!
- Prep Time: 15 minutes
- Cook Time: 30 minutes
- Total Time: 45 minutes
- Yield: 12 bars
- Category: Dessert
- Method: Baking
- Cuisine: American
- Diet: Vegetarian
Ingredients
- 2 cups all-purpose flour
- 1 cup brown sugar
- 1/2 cup unsalted butter, melted
- 1 teaspoon baking powder
- 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
- 1/4 teaspoon salt
- 2 large eggs
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1 cup icing sugar
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a 9×13 inch baking pan.
- In a large bowl, mix the flour, brown sugar, melted butter, baking powder, cinnamon, and salt until combined.
- Beat in the eggs and vanilla extract until smooth.
- Pour the mixture into the prepared baking pan and spread evenly.
- Bake for 25-30 minutes or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ean.
- Let cool before icing with the glaze made from icing sugar and a splash of water.
Notes
- Make sure to let the bars cool completely before icing for the best texture.
- These bars can be stored in an airtight container for up to a week.
